Experience the mesmerizing avant-garde jazz of Sun Ra and his Cosmo Discipline Arkestra with the limited edition first pressing LP, "A Night in East Berlin." This rare vinyl record features 3 autographs and an original cover, making it a must-have for jazz enthusiasts and collectors alike. The record is in mint condition, both in terms of the vinyl and the near mint sleeve grading. Released by Leo Records in 1987, this 12" record with 33 RPM and stereo audio channels showcases Sun Ra's unique style and impeccable composition skills. The music is a perfect blend of English and German influences, taking you on a musical journey that is both surreal and delightful. Catalog number LR 149, this vinyl record is a treasure trove for collectors and music lovers. Recorded June 28, 1986 Signed By June Tyson, James Jacson, and Marshall Allen. signed in Chicago 1991 at the Cubby Bear, Sun Ra was to ill to sign anything i just held his hand for a minute. I got to be friends with June, James and Marshall, I talked with Sun Ra alot and even on the phone He was the greatest of all time.
